In 1895 Goerz founded a branch in New York that started its own production in 1902 and was to become the C. Goerz American Optical Co. In 1905 (see here for dating these serial numbers). This company continued to operate independently in the US until 1972. Until WWI many great companies cooperated with Goerz.

Goerz Dagor C.P. Goerz Bremen Dopp-Anastigmaat Serie III Dagor. This is certainly one of the nearly all celebrated zoom lens design actually. More than one hundred decades after its introduction it is definitely nevertheless a quite usable lens. It has been in 1982 that a mathematician Emil von Hoegh, 27 years old, proposed to Zeiss this double anastigmat containing of two triplets symmetrically arranged around the f halt. Zeiss had been not interested, probably because two yrs previously they had launched their own anastigmat. Therefore Emil had taken it to the also very younger firm Goerz in Berlin.

Just four years older, Goerz was making a Fast Rectilinear lens known as Lynkeioskop, one of the best RR variations. That was the beginning of a large achievement. By 1895 some 30.000 had been already sold.

The name Dagor had been adopted only in 1904 and the style was certified to almost every lens maker ever since. It is usually a convertible lens. That means one can make use of just one cell placed behind the iris.

In that case the combined foci is usually increased by 1,73, but as a industry off there can be a substantial reduction in luminosity.
